Description from the seller

A unique Comtoise clock in a modern jacket, crafted in clear plexiglass. The clock is equipped with a bronze bell and a stunning enamel cartouche, with a fully visible mechanical movement. This clock is a real eye-catcher and blends functionality with a fascinating design. The Roman numerals are clearly readable, and the weights contribute to the classic look. Perfect for enthusiasts of distinctive timepieces or as a decorative element in a modern or industrial interior.

Dimensions are: 25 cm high, 25 cm wide and 15 cm deep.
The clock runs and strikes as it should.
Complete with a winding crank.
